Python提供了多种方法来取矩阵的某几行。在本文中,将介绍三种常用的方法:切片、循环和列表推导。通过这些方法,您可以轻松地从矩阵中提取所需的行。
## 1. 使用切片方法
切片是Python中常用的一种方法,可以通过指定开始和结束索引来截取列表或其他可迭代对象的一部分。对于矩阵来说,我们可以使用切片来取得所需的行。
下面是一个示例代码:
```python
matrix = [[1, 2
原创
2023-12-19 03:59:45
547阅读
# Python提取矩阵的某几行
## 导言
在Python中,提取矩阵的某几行是一个常见的操作。对于刚入行的小白来说,可能不清楚如何实现这个功能。本文将指导你如何使用Python提取矩阵的某几行,并提供详细的步骤和示例代码。
## 整体流程
对于提取矩阵的某几行这个任务,我们可以分为以下几个步骤来完成:
1. 导入所需的库
2. 创建矩阵
3. 提取指定行的子矩阵
下面我们将逐步介绍每
原创
2023-08-10 18:24:38
205阅读
## Python选取矩阵的某几行
### 介绍
在Python中,我们可以使用NumPy库来处理矩阵和数组。选取矩阵的某几行可以通过切片操作来实现。在本文中,我将向你展示如何用Python选取矩阵的某几行,以及详细解释每个操作的代码和意义。
### 流程
下面是选取矩阵的某几行的流程:
|步骤|操作|代码|
|---|---|---|
|1|导入NumPy库|`import numpy a
原创
2023-10-09 11:13:46
182阅读
# Python提取矩阵某几行
## 简介
在进行数据处理和分析时,经常需要从大型矩阵中提取特定的几行作为子集。Python是一种功能强大且易于使用的编程语言,提供了多种方法来实现这一功能。本文将介绍几种常用的方法,让您能够在Python中轻松地提取矩阵的某几行。
## 方法一:使用切片操作
Python中的切片操作是一种非常常用的方法,可以方便地提取列表、字符串和数组等数据类型的子集。对
原创
2023-10-09 03:38:57
136阅读
# Python取CSV的某几行
CSV(Comma Separated Values)是一种常见的用于存储表格数据的文件格式。在数据分析和处理中,我们经常需要从CSV文件中提取一部分数据进行操作和分析。本文将介绍如何使用Python来取得CSV文件的某几行数据。
## 准备工作
在开始之前,我们需要先准备一个CSV文件作为示例数据。可以使用Excel或者任何文本编辑器创建一个CSV文件,文
原创
2023-08-15 14:48:24
402阅读
# Python List 取某几行的操作
在Python中,列表(List)是一种非常常用的数据结构,它可以存储多个元素,并且支持各种操作。有时候我们需要从列表中取出其中的某几行,这时就需要用到切片(slice)操作。
## 什么是切片操作
切片操作是指通过指定起始索引和结束索引来截取列表中的一部分元素。其基本语法是`list[start:end]`,其中`start`表示起始索引,`en
原创
2024-03-03 06:37:30
200阅读
# Python取矩阵的特定几行
## 引言
在进行数据处理和分析时,我们经常会遇到需要从一个矩阵中提取特定几行数据的情况。Python作为一门强大的编程语言,提供了多种方法来实现这一目标。本文将介绍几种常见的方法,包括使用切片、使用列表生成式和使用NumPy库。通过本文的学习,读者将理解如何在Python中高效地取特定几行矩阵数据。
## 1. 使用切片操作
切片是Python中一种非常
原创
2023-09-06 03:22:49
357阅读
print(X.shape):查看矩阵的行列号
print(len(X)):查看矩阵的行数
print(X.ndim):查看矩阵的维数
转载
2023-06-07 09:54:10
323阅读
在神经网络计算过程中,经常会遇到需要将矩阵中的某些元素取出并且单独进行计算的步骤(例如MLE,Attention等操作)。那么在 tensorflow 的 Variable 类型中如何做到这一点呢?首先假设 Variable 是一个一维数组 A:1
2
3
4
5
6
7
import numpy as np
import tensorflow as tf
a= np.array([1,2,3,4
转载
2024-08-23 20:45:01
32阅读
## Python 取某几行中的几列
### 1. 简介
在Python中,想要从一个数据集中只取出所需的某几行中的某几列是很常见的需求。在本文中,我将向你介绍如何实现这个功能。
### 2. 流程图
下面是整个流程的流程图:
```mermaid
flowchart TD
A[读取数据集] --> B[选择需要的行]
B --> C[选择需要的列]
C -->
原创
2023-08-16 14:28:31
449阅读
# Python取TXT中某几行的实现方法
## 1. 引言
在Python中,我们可以使用简单的代码来读取并处理文本文件。本文将向你展示如何使用Python来读取和提取TXT文件中的指定行。
## 2. 实现步骤
首先,让我们通过一个表格来展示整个实现过程的步骤:
| 步骤 | 描述 |
| --- | --- |
| 步骤一 | 打开TXT文件 |
| 步骤二 | 逐行读取TXT文件内
原创
2023-11-12 04:40:47
150阅读
这次给大家带来Python numpy怎么提取矩阵的指定行列,Python numpy提取矩阵指定行列的注意事项有哪些,下面就是实战案例,一起来看一下。如下所示:import numpy as np
a=np.arange(9).reshape(3,3)a
Out[31]:
array([[0, 1, 2],
[3, 4, 5],
[6, 7, 8]])
矩阵的某一行a[1]
Out[32]: a
转载
2023-06-03 20:02:03
365阅读
# Python中如何取矩阵里某列空值的行
在数据处理和分析中,我们经常需要处理包含大量数据的矩阵。有时候我们需要找出某一列中空值的行,以便进一步处理或分析。在Python中,我们可以使用numpy库来方便地完成这个任务。
## numpy库简介
numpy是Python中一个强大的数值计算库,提供了高效的数组操作和数学函数。我们可以使用numpy来创建、操作和处理多维数组,也就是我们常说的
原创
2024-07-07 04:54:57
40阅读
这个操作在numpy数组上的操作感觉有点麻烦,但是也没办法。 例如 a = [[1,2,3], [4,5,6], [7,8,9]] 取 a 的 2 3 行, 1 2 列c=[1,2] d =[0,1]若写为 b = a[c,d] output: [4 8] 取的是 第二行第一列 和第三行第二列的数据 这并不是我们想要的结果。正确做法是: b = a[c]先取想要...
原创
2021-07-05 11:07:24
7461阅读
# Python 取矩阵中特定几行
作为一名经验丰富的开发者,我将向刚入行的小白介绍如何使用 Python 从矩阵中取出特定的几行。我们将使用表格来展示整个过程的步骤,然后逐步解释每一步需要做什么,以及相应的代码。
## 步骤概览
下面是完成这个任务的整个流程的步骤概览:
| 步骤 | 描述 |
| --- | --- |
| 步骤1 | 创建一个矩阵 |
| 步骤2 | 确定要取出的行数
原创
2023-11-24 05:11:30
55阅读
这个操作在numpy数组上的操作感觉有点麻烦,但是也没办法。 例如 a = [[1,2,3], [4,5,6], [7,8,9]] 取 a 的 2 3 行, 1 2 列c=[1,2] d =[0,1]若写为 b = a[c,d] output: [4 8] 取的是 第二行第一列 和第三行第二列的数据 这并不是我们想要的结果。正确做法是: b = a[c]先取想要...
转载
2022-03-15 10:09:10
1685阅读
python如何选取数据的第几行和第几列要选取Python中数据的特定行和列,可以使用索引或切片。假设你有一个名为data的二维列表(或Numpy数组或Pandas DataFrame),以下是如何选择第3行和第2列:# 选择第3行和第2列
third_row_second_column = data[2][1]这里2表示第3行,因为Python中的索引从0开始计数,而1表示第2列,因为我们在列表
转载
2023-07-27 19:03:43
121阅读
作者:郭俊麟 | 清华伯克利 数据科学 人工智能作为近10年最火的学科之一,背后却有着三大基础学科支持着他的发展,分别是线性代数,微积分,还有概率论,对于各式各样的经典算法,无一例外的都用到了矩阵来承载来自不同维度的数据,而许多人的一大烦恼就是知道原理却无从下手代码的实践,显然一大原因是对实现算法的编程语言或者函数库不够熟悉,以下小编将从 Python 编程语言的角度来从头回顾线性
转载
2023-08-23 01:13:30
62阅读
# 如何使用 Python xlrd 取某几行数据
## 1. 整个流程
```mermaid
pie
title Python xlrd 取数据流程
"读取 Excel 文件" : 25
"获取指定行数据" : 25
"处理数据" : 25
"输出结果" : 25
```
```mermaid
flowchart TD
A[读取 Excel
原创
2024-02-25 04:49:47
105阅读
## Python矩阵取某几列的实现方法
### 概述
在Python中,要取一个矩阵的某几列,可以通过以下步骤来实现:
1. 创建一个矩阵;
2. 根据指定的列索引,遍历矩阵的每一行,将指定列的元素添加到一个新的列表中;
3. 返回新的列表作为结果。
下面我将详细介绍每一步需要做的事情。
### 创建一个矩阵
首先,我们需要创建一个矩阵。在Python中,我们可以使用列表的列表来表示
原创
2024-02-12 08:18:39
73阅读